General Thomas Carleton was an Irish-born British Army officer who was promoted to colonel during the American Revolutionary War after relieving the siege of Quebec in 1776. Wikipedia
Born: 1735, Ireland
Died: February 2, 1817 (age 82 years), Ramsgate, United Kingdom
Nephews: William Carleton, unknown son Carleton, Christopher Carleton, and more
Previous office: Lieutenant Governor of New Brunswick (1786–1817)
Parents: Catherine Ball and Christopher Carleton
